IP查询
查询
你查询的IP:[159.226.91.154] 地理位置:中国–北京–北京科技网
最新查询
124.192.63.149
114.54.23.113
119.254.225.81
118.178.148.84
122.224.43.127
221.129.171.80
210.21.111.201
221.129.102.19
222.248.52.155
159.226.91.154
202.101.176.211
120.48.173.4
59.191.240.52
60.208.235.250
119.40.128.133
119.42.32.231
124.64.6.122
116.13.35.166
119.32.184.143
202.136.48.233
123.112.74.38
221.12.128.138
58.14.185.227
118.66.49.88
210.76.187.35
203.118.192.195
202.38.149.241
122.224.159.192
118.192.192.69
117.100.169.121
117.121.192.149